






Kenneth Galloway of Gallows Custom Creations gave this 1971 Chevrolet Truck a timeless new look with Tamco Paint’s My Boy Blue. Known for its deep, refined hue, My Boy Blue delivers a clean and classic finish that perfectly complements the vintage lines of this Chevy.
With four coats of My Boy Blue laid over a solid foundation of HP5312 White DTM (Direct to Metal) Primer Kit, and sealed with HC2104 High Solids Clearcoat, the result is a flawless, glossy finish that radiates style and sophistication. Kenneth’s craftsmanship, paired with Tamco’s trusted products, turned this classic truck into a polished showpiece.
Painter: Kenneth Galloway
Shop Name: Gallows Custom Creations
Tamco Products used for this look:
- HP5312 White DTM (Direct to Metal) Primer Kit
- My Boy Blue ( 4 Coats )
- HR Reducers
- HC2104 High Solids Clearcoat
